MEMORANDUM
The order denying the Maddens’ motion to dissolve the injunction granted by the federal district court is vacated. The cause is remanded to the district court for further proceedings, in which the district court shall give full faith and credit to the judgment of the Washington court, as affirmed by the Supreme Court of Washington. (State ex rel. Madden v. Public Utility District No. 1, 83 Wash.2d 219, 517 P.2d 585 (1974).)
